Default [Spaceships] Improving the ship's Complexity Rating.

For my under construction space setting, I have made it so your ship's maximum cruising speed is controlled by the Complexity Rating of the ship's network. The idea being that the more processing power you throw at the engines, the more efficiently they can slip through subspace like greased lightning (i.e. speed boost without significantly increasing power demand).

So was wondering, have I overlooked some way to improve a ship's CR without increasing either size or TL? If there isn't, I might be able to cludge something together from the ultra-tech computers and make a dedicated computer ship system. But I would like to avoid that if possible.
